**FeedCheck Validator — Onboarding**

FeedCheck validates podcast RSS feeds for the Larkspur ingestion pipeline. On-call duties: watch the malformed-feed queue, requeue transient failures, and flag schema changes upstream. Runbooks live in the Larkspur wiki under Validation. If a publisher escalates or the queue backs up past an hour, contact the ingestion team directly.

escalation mailbox, yajeg-bageg: quenax.olidor@lumiccorp.internal

Runbook: Tidewipe Sweeper — weekly sync notes. The sweeper scans the Larkfield archive tier nightly and tombstones records past their retention class before hard deletion on the third pass. Verify the dry-run counter matches the audit ledger before enabling destructive mode; any mismatch over 0.5% should be escalated to the Quillbrook data team. The current production values are as follows.

config for hahip-kaguf:
[holath]
port = 8443
region = north-4
host = holath.tolvaqlabs.internal
timeout_ms = 1000
retries = 2

TICKET: Planner regression after env drift on Oakmere replica.

Queries on `orders_flat` went from 40ms to 9s. Cause: `PLANNER_STATS_TARGET` was reset to 10 in `.env.replica` during last night's redeploy; should be 500. Fixed and re-analyzed — latency back to normal. Also noticed the stats-refresh cron failed auth because its credential was wiped in the same drift. Restore it by adding the stats service secret on the next line.

vault entry, hahaf-tafog: VAULT_KEY3=38a

## Environment variables — Tailwick internal log-tailing CLI

Tailwick streams logs from our Hollowpine aggregator to engineer workstations. From a security standpoint, note that `TAILWICK_REDACT=on` is enforced at the server and cannot be disabled client-side; `TAILWICK_RETENTION_HINT` is advisory only. Sessions are read-only and scoped per team. Every audit-relevant action is logged server-side with the caller's identity. The CLI authenticates with a short-lived token, which the env file declares on the line that follows.

env line for kawef-bajop: VAULT_KEY13=bcea803fc73c3